Thrace, Mesembria. Philip II, Caesar. As Caesar, A.D. 244-247. AE 26 (25.60 mm, 10.66 g, 2 h). [MAP IOV]ΛIOC ΦIΛIΠΠO-C // KAICA / P, Confronted bare-headed, draped bust of Philip II right and Serapis, draped and wearing modius left / MECAMB-[PIA]NΩN, Hygeia (Salus) standing facing, head right, feeding from patera serpent she holds in arms. Varbanov 4921 ; BMC, Thrace, 135,22.. VF, somwhat weakly-struck at edge, losing a few letters obverse and reverse; die flaw reverse; decent patina.
